How much is car insurance?
This is not always an easy question to answer. Insurance rates are based on a lot of factors like your location where your car is garaged, which coverage types and amounts your chose to have on your policy, and your driving history. The largest part of your premium costs are in the liability section. Insuring the vehicle is cheaper is next.
Since no two drivers are the same, auto insurance companies must look deeply into each individual’s personal driving history to assess various risk factors when determining a car insurance quote. Companies may use factors like where you live geographically. What is that areas population density, crime rates, weather patterns? Do you drive in the city, suburban or rural areas? Are there a lot of people driving in that area which would mean more cars and traffic, which increases the risk of theft or accidents.
CAR MAKE AND MODEL
Your vehicle make and model affect how auto insurance companies calculate your premium rates.
ACCIDENT RATES
Driving a vehicle with a history of recent accidents will increase your auto insurance premium rates.
COST OF REPAIRS
Some vehicles’ parts are expensive to replace. Some parts are hard to find with older vehicles.
DRIVING HISTORY
Insurers methodically weigh various elements of your driving history to determine how likely you are to file a claim. The higher your liklihood to file a claim, the higher the rate your insurance premium will be. Each insurer has its own way to determine each person’s risk level. After the insurance company calculates their base rate, insurance costs are as unique as you ar. Therefore, insurance rate comparison tools are a sure-fire way to find the cheapest quote for the best coverage.
AGE
Younger drivers can exhibit reckless behavior on the road, like speeding or driving under the influence. This tendency, coupled with inexperience, means teen drivers pay more expensive car insurance premiums of any age of drivers on the road today.
After gaining safe experience on the road, age 25-30 is the age range that teen drivers start to see savings on their car insurance rates.
THEFT RATES
Living in a zip code with frequent incidents of vehicle theft and vandalism will cause your auto insurance rates to increase. Insurance companies break the zip codes down into territories and assign a risk level to each. The higher the risk level, the higher the premium. It is wise to check insurance rates before you move to a new location.
INSURANCE CLAIMS
Every insurance carrier has a different experience level of claims with each type of car. Some car models have a higher frequency of being stolen. Will every insurance carrier insure the same car for the same rate? Never. Driving a car model with a high number of claims, including fraudulent ones, will affect your premium rates.
ANNUAL MILEAGE
Your estimated annual mileage shows how much you are on the road, and therefore how much risk you are at for an accident.
PRIMARY USE OF VEHICLE

CREDIT SCORE
Almost every major insurer will use a driver’s credit score as a rating factor when providing an auto insurance quote. The lower the credit scrore will create the higher insurance premium. Historically, drivers with a lower credit score are more likely to file insurance claims, thus presenting a higher risk to insurance companies.
OTHER FACTORS TO KNOW
Red flags found in your driving history, like speeding tickets, DUIs, previous accidents, are important to insurers. A minor accident or violation can increase your insurance rates for the next few years.
Drivers with an at-fault accident on your record poses a higher risk level to the insurance companies than those with a clean record. When you are at a higher risk, you will pay a higher premium.
The best way to find the cheapest car insurance policy is by comparing quotes from multiple insurance companies side-by-side and figuring out which company gives you the best deal.
